第三章 主機規劃與磁碟分割槽

2021-07-13 03:41:15 字數 2012 閱讀 1568

牢記:各個元件或裝置在linux下面都是乙個檔案,在/dev/目錄下

分割槽:例如,windows中乙個硬碟分割槽後cdef四個盤;

兩種常見的磁碟介面:ide、sata(目前應用多)

1、主機提供2個ide介面,每個介面可以連線2個ide裝置,也就是說主機可以連線到4個ide裝置,對應的linux檔名為:dev/hda,b,c,d

2、sata裝置以及usb裝置對應的名稱為:dev/sd[a~p],按識別先後順序命名,sata會被先識別,usb後識別。

磁碟:碟片、機械手臂、刺頭、主馬達;磁碟的每個扇區為512byte,其中第一扇區特別重要。

第一扇區記錄的兩個重要資訊:

1、主引導分割槽(master boot record mbr):可以安裝引導引導程式的地方,有446byte,開機時,系統首先回去讀取的部分

2、分割槽表(partition table):記錄整塊硬碟分割槽的狀態,64byte,作用是標識是硬碟的分割槽情況。

第一扇區64byte大小的分割槽表將硬碟分為四個部分(預設):

1、對映到linux裝置檔名中分別為:/dev/hda1,2,3,4

2、注意:分割槽顯示對第一扇區的64byte大小的分割槽變進行分割槽,在對映到硬碟的分割槽;

3、分割槽的好處:安全 + (搜尋、儲存)效能;

第一扇區的分割槽表只能記錄4組分區資訊,但是可以利用額外的扇區記錄更多的分割槽資訊

1、主分割槽可以有1~4個,擴充套件分割槽可以有0~1個。

2、邏輯分割槽裝置名稱從hda5開始,前四個保留給主分割槽以及擴充套件分割槽

3、邏輯分割槽可以理解成是擴充套件分割槽的再次擴充

cmos :記錄了各項硬體引數且嵌入在主機板上面的儲存器;

bios:寫入到主機板上的韌體(所謂韌體就是寫入到硬體上的乙個軟體程式),計算機一開機第乙個執行的程式就是這個bios程式

開機啟動流程:

1、開機後,計算機執行bios韌體,讀取硬體裝置資訊(例如,硬碟中的程式(簡單來說就是啟動作業系統));

2、讀取第乙個扇區中mbr資訊(裡面包含了乙個引導引導程式)

3、通過引導引導程式,讀取核心資訊,執行作業系統功能

引導引導程式除了可以安裝在mbr之外,還可以安裝在每個分割槽的引導扇區

1、例如計算機中安裝了兩個以上的引導引導程式時,第

一、二分別windows/linux

2、實際可開機的核心檔案是放置在mbr內或者各個分區內。

3、引導載入檔案中只會識別自己分割槽中的核心檔案以及其它loader

目錄樹結構

1、根目錄:「/」

2、linux中的資料表面上是放在目錄中,但是我們知道,資料其實是放在分割槽中的,這就涉及到掛載:目錄樹的架構與磁碟內資料的結合

檔案系統與目錄樹的關係(掛載)

1、掛載:將磁碟分割槽中的資料放置在相應的目錄下,即訪問該目錄就等於讀取該分割槽,進入的這個目錄成為掛載點;

2、一般稱之為:xx光碟機掛載到xx目錄下,window使用光碟機的方式存數資料(cdef盤)、linux使用目錄

安裝distributions掛載點與磁碟分割槽的規劃:選用自定義安裝,custom而不要選用預設(可以學到好多東西)

1、初次安裝:只要分割槽「/」和「swap」(交換分割槽)即可;

2、分割槽時建議預留乙個備用的剩餘空間磁碟容量

伺服器選擇red hat enterprise或者suse enterprise linux

這裡選用centos

主機硬碟的規劃:

1、簡單的分割槽方法:只分為根目錄與記憶體交換空間 + 一些預留空間(不安全)

2、根據實際需求進行分割槽

Linux私房菜 第三章 主機規劃和磁碟分割槽

工作機還是遊戲機?價效比的考慮,如果高一級的產品讓你的花費多一倍,但是新增加的效能只有10 價效比就太低了 支援性考慮 如果企業用計算機不要自行組裝,購買商業伺服器較佳,因為廠家散熱,穩定度,防雷等等 各硬體裝置在linux是以檔案形式存在的 裝置裝置在linux內的檔名 ide硬碟 淘汰了 dev...

主機規劃與磁碟分割槽 磁碟分割槽 MBR

主流的磁碟介面為sata介面。sata usb scsi等磁碟介面都是使用scsi模組來驅動的,因此這些介面的磁碟裝置檔名都是 dev sd a p 的格式。順序需要根據linux核心檢測到磁碟的順序來決定。比如pc上面有兩個sata磁碟以及乙個usb磁碟,而主機板上面有6個sata的插槽。這兩個s...

主機規劃與磁碟分割槽

在linux裡面,各個元件或裝置都是乙個檔案 1 linux伺服器中,記憶體的重要性比cpu還要高得多 2 磁碟陣列 是利用硬體技術將數個硬碟整合成為乙個大硬碟的方法,作業系統只會看到最後被整合起來的大硬碟。3 各硬體裝置在linux中的檔名 1 ide介面的硬碟在linux內的檔名為 dev hd...